Why You Sweat More in the Spring
After months of cooler weather, your body is not fully adjusted to heat. As temperatures climb, your system works harder to cool you down.
Here is what is happening:
- Warmer air increases body temperature
- Your sweat glands become more active
- Outdoor activity picks up again
- Layers of clothing trap heat
Your body is doing its job. Sweat helps regulate temperature and keep you from overheating.
Why Odor Can Get Worse
Sweat itself does not smell. Bacteria on your skin break it down and create odor.
When you sweat more, you give those bacteria more to work with. That is why odor tends to ramp up in spring. If you are still using heavy winter products or skipping daily care, it shows fast.

Step Two: Clean Up Your Routine
Warmer weather means your routine needs to tighten up a bit.
Simple changes make a difference:
- Shower daily, especially after workouts
- Use a gentle body wash that does not strip your skin
- Dry off completely before applying deodorant
- Apply deodorant to clean skin
Skipping steps in spring leads to buildup and stronger odor.
Step Three: Watch Your Clothing
Fabric matters more than most guys think.
Heavy or non breathable materials trap sweat and heat. That creates a perfect environment for odor.
Go with:
- Lightweight fabrics
- Breathable cotton or performance blends
- Clean shirts each day
If your shirt smells, it does not matter how good your deodorant is.
